Evil - Season 2

Season 2
The second season brings evil closer to home. Kristen struggles with her darker nature, while David suffers temptation as he gets closer to his ordination. Meanwhile Ben is visited by night terrors that prey on his greatest fears.
Episodes

N Is for Night Terrors
The team is given the task of evaluating the likelihood of Leland being possessed, which if decided true, would require them to exorcise him.

A Is for Angel
The team is charged with investigating a man who claims that he is hearing an angel.

F Is for Fire
The team encounters a nine-year-old girl, Mathilda, who is seemingly haunted by a Jinn, a spirit in the Islamic faith.

E Is for Elevator
The team is sent to investigate the disappearance of a teenage boy, Wyatt.

Z Is for Zombies
Father Mulvehill asks the team for a confidential evaluation, as he fears that he might be the victim of diabolical oppression.

C Is for Cop
After the shooting of an unarmed woman, the team is tasked with investigating the police officer who pulled the trigger.

S Is for Silence
The team is dispatched to a monastery to investigate the corpse of Father Thomas, whose body has not decayed in the year following his death.

B Is for Brain
Kristen, David, and Ben are sent to Cornell University, at the request of Bishop Marx, to investigate an electrode-based experiment dubbed the "God Helmet."

U Is for U.F.O.
Bishop Marx tasks the team to investigate a UFO sighting, spotted by an air force pilot.

O Is for Ovaphobia
Ben, David, and Kristen investigate the RSM Fertility clinic - since so many of their past cases have led back to the ominous clinic.

I Is for IRS
The IRS taps the team to investigate the legitimacy of a new organization seeking religious status for tax exemption.

D Is for Doll
At Dr. Boggs' request, the team is introduced to a recently widowed Catholic named Nathan, and his teenage son, Elijah.

C Is for Cannibal
The team is sent to meet on campus with Mitch Otterbean, a student with a growing compulsion to eat human flesh.
